Ongoing discussions regarding a new central administration building for San Marcos Consolidated ISD will continue during Monday’s regular board of trustees meeting.
The board recently approved a contract with Stantec Architecture Inc. for architectural services for a central office building during its Sept. 20 meeting. SMCISD administrators relocated in late 2017 to a temporary central office location at 631 Mill St. after mold was found in the previous office.
The approved contract consists of a feasibility study, which includes facility assessment and longrange facility plans, recommendations and cost estimates and test fits for an administration building. The contract would also include an administration building project if it receives board approval.
